What Native American Tribe lived in Georgia?

Primarily Muscogee Creek people, and later Cherokee tribe lived in Georgia. Historical tribes that lived there also include the Eufaula, Guale, Hitchiti, Ibi, Yamacraw, and Yamasee peoples.


What are yaqui's considered?

Yaqui's are considered Native American. The Yaqui were federally recognized by the United States government as a historical tribe in September 18, 1978.


What languages were spoken by the Jumano people?

Nobody really knows. There aren't many historical records of this tribe, which went extinct in the 18th Century.
